Banana Oatmeal Bars Easy Healthy Snack

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 12 bars
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

These banana oatmeal bars are soft, chewy, and use simple pantry ingredients. They make a healthy baked snack or breakfast ideal for meal preparation.


Ingredients

  • 1½ cups mashed ripe bananas
  • ½ cup almond butter
  • 2 cups old-fashioned rolled oats
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 3 tablespoons maple syrup
  • 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• ½ teaspoon salt


Instructions

  1. Heat your oven to 350°F. Line a 9 x 9-inch baking pan with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, combine the mashed bananas and almond butter. Stir until the mixture is smooth.
  3. Add the rolled oats, cinnamon, maple syrup, chocolate chips, and salt. Mix everything until it combines well.
  4. Put the mixture into the prepared pan. Press it down firmly into an even layer.
  5. Bake for 18 to 20 minutes. Look for lightly golden edges and a set center.
  6. Take the pan out of the oven. Let the bars cool completely in the pan.
  7. Slice the bars after they have cooled completely.

Notes

  • Allow the bars to cool fully. This helps them firm up and keep their shape when you slice them.
